Marhu is a free, open-source software application for note taking, task management, and personal knowledge base creation. Inspired by tools like Roam Research and Obsidian, Marhu allows users to take notes, organize information, plan tasks, save web content, and manage files in one unified system.
At the core of Marhu is a flexible notebook and tag system. Users can create notebooks to group related notes, pages, files, etc. Things can also be tagged with multiple categories. This makes it easy to link concepts across notes and retrieve things later with searches and filters.
